Analysis

In 2023, other investment, currency and deposits, deposit taking corporations in Suriname stood at 3,622 US dollar per square kilometre.

Compared with earlier readings it is up 37.1% on the previous year and down 23.6% over ten years.

Over the whole period, other investment, currency and deposits, deposit taking corporations in Suriname peaked at 4,821 US dollar per square kilometre in 2018 and was at its lowest, 2,405 US dollar per square kilometre, in 2019.

That places Suriname 124th out of 165 countries with data for 2023, putting it in the bottom quarter.

The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 13 years of available data.

How this figure is calculated

Other investment, Currency and deposits, Deposit taking corporations, except the Central Bank (Assets, Positions, US dollar) divided by Land area (sq. km), mat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.

Other investment, Currency and deposits, Deposit taking corporations, except the Central Bank (Assets, Positions, US dollar) ÷ Land area (sq. km)
